  5. It sounds like the a/c belt and the only thing it runs is the a/c compressor so you wont hurt anything, you just wont have any a/c. It is very simple to change and I would suggest changing out the tensioner at the same time. Change it by going up through the bottom, under the truck. That is what I found to be easiest. Also, to get to the a/c belt, you have to remove the main serpentine belt (the a/c belt sits behind the main belt). While you are at it, I would change the main serpentine belt and tensioner also. To get the main belt off you have to remove the intake tube first, then the fan shroud. It really isn't difficult at all and shouldn't take much time to do.

  11. I had issues with a evap issue when I first bought the truck but I don't remember what code it threw. Anyway, the Honda dealer I bought the truck from insisted it was the gas cap and replaced it twice before I finally told them it was going to the GM dealer. The GM dealer told them the the canister thing that is located by the gas can needed to be replaced but the Honda dealer didn't want to spend the $, so, they replaced the gas cap again. Light came back on. I finally told them to have the GM dealer replace the canister or they could have this 2 week old truck back. Canister replaced and have not had the problem since. I think it was either P0440 P0442 but it was three years ago, I don't remember.
